Are Summer Overnight Camps Safe for Children?

Parents are always on a look out for activities to keep their children constructively busy during long summer break. One of the most preferred and popular options happen to be sending them to summer camps. Depending on your children’s age and comfort level you can opt for summer overnight camps where kids stay with other children in camps or day camps where they come back every night to their homes.

Selecting the best summer overnight camp or sleep-away camp can be quite a taxing task for parents who want to ensure every possible comfort and safety for their children. Many parents are not comfortable sending their kids to overnight camp as they are not sure if it’s safe or not. The camps are usually organised with proper planning and preparation. Safety of every child is given the top priority while deciding the activities and location of a camp.

Every camp has adult supervisors who are called counsellors. They are also known as cabin leaders. Each counsellor is in-charge of a small group of campers, who reside in small batches called bunks, huts, cabins, or units. Same aged children are housed in cabins with their own bed and cubbies to place their things. Counsellors keep a close watch and usually share living accommodations with campers. This ensures that they are able to keep round the clock supervision on the kids.

Registered Nurses and a Medical Doctor are present at the infirmary located at the camp site throughout the camp. They are prepared to handle any emergency situation. In case campers need to remain overnight in the infirmary, parents are notified immediately of the same. Depending on your comfort level, you can send your children to co-ed, all boys, or all girls sleep-away camps.

Many activities are planned at summer overnight camps to keep children busy at all times. You can choose from various camps that cover activities like sports, community service such as building homes or going on archaeological digs, performing arts, music, magic, computers, language learning, mathematics, and weight loss.
